  1. What difference does the Resurrection make? • Matthew chapter 28 • The resurrection means that: • Jesus is who He claimed to be • Jesus does have the power He claimed to have • Jesus does do what He promises • So what difference does this make for us • in NZ or Indonesia in 2011?

  2. 1. MY PAST CAN BE FORGIVEN “He [Jesus] has forgiven all our sins and cancelled every record of the debt we owed. Christ has done away with it by nailing it to the cross." (Col 3v14) Jesus says, “I have come to give you life in all its fullness.” (Jn 10 v10) Jesus also said, “You will know the truth, and the truth will set you free." (Jn 8 v32) Apostle Paul said, “There is no condemnation awaiting those who belong to Christ.” (Roms 8 v1)

  3. 2. MY PRESENT LIFE CAN BE WELL LIVED Apostle Paul says, "How incredibly great is God’s power to help those who believe Him, the same mighty power that raised Christ from the dead." (Cols 1 v20) And, "I'm ready for anything through the strength of Christ who lives in me." (Phil 4 v13)

  4. 3. MY FUTURE CAN BE SECURE Jesus said, “I am the way the truth and the life, no one comes to the Father except through me.” (Jn 14 v6) “I am the res and the life. Those who believe in me (who go on believing in me) even though they die, will live again. They are given eternal life for believing in me and will never perish.” (Jn 11 v25) "This is the way to have eternal life. By knowing the only true God and Jesus Christ the one He sent to earth." (Jn 17 v3)

  5. Jesus calls us to make a difference in our world Christians have a difficult task, not because the message isn’t attractive but because we aren’t always attractive messengers. People are not as open to the truth because they don’t believe truth-tellers can be trusted. To establish fresh trust, we must first show our ability to love, through real and relevant acts of service; acts of unexpected kindness. To tell the truth we must show the truth.
